Released January 24th, 2015, 'Ratter' stars Ashley Benson, Matt McGorry, Michael William Freeman, Rebecca Naomi Jones The NR mov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 20 min, and received a user score of 52 (out of 100) on TMDb, which collated reviews from 306 respected users.
What, so now you want to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Emma is a young and beautiful graduate student just starting a new life in New York City. Like most people her age, she is always connected - her phone and laptop are constant companions, documenting her most intimate moments. What she doesn't realize is that she's sharing her life with an uninvited and dangerous guest. A hacker is following Emma’s every move. When the voyeuristic thrill of watching her digitally isn't enough, the situation escalates to a dangerous and terrifying level."
